Output 5e0f7ecde8048d29360cf81a79bb247ad9a4f44dbb9e45d2bafd5d699b4641d2:0

value
10477089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c25ed49713f5dac5d3a044e99500f6de8e6887 OP_EQUAL
address
3NpSrx785fTZtuAHCi4Ezvx4k6GiNe5vyH
transaction
5e0f7ecde8048d29360cf81a79bb247ad9a4f44dbb9e45d2bafd5d699b4641d2
confirmations
407279
spent
true